Your roommate fell asleep about 25 minutes ago. Now, you need to awaken him so that you both can get to a party on time. He is s

leeptalking about his girlfriend's cat. When you begin laughing, he wakes up. He was in the nrem-_____ stage of sleep.
Social Studies
1 answer:
Llana [10]4 years ago
5 0

Before my roomate was woken up by my laughter, he was in the third NON-REM stage of sleep.

Stage 3 is deep sleep, and during this stage, a person may experience sleeptalking, sleepwalking, bedwetting, nightmares, etc. The term we use for these behaviors is parasomnias and usually happen between NON-REM and REM sleep.

what is electrical college? how does it work? why did our fore-fathers create it? what are some pros and cons?​
otez555 [7]

Answer:

The Electoral College is a body of electors established by the United States Constitution, constituted every four years for the sole purpose of electing the president and vice president of the United States. The founding fathers established it in the Constitution as a compromise between election of the President by a vote in Congress and election of the President by a popular vote of qualified citizens. When voters go to the polls, they will be choosing which candidate receives their state's electors.

Taylor had a preterm baby born in the 36th week of conception. Taylor has been asked to hold her preterm infant against her bare
rjkz [21]

Answer:

Kangaroo care                                                                                                

Explanation:

Kangaroo care: In psychology, the term kangaroo care is defined as a method in which the parents hold a baby in a way that creates a skin-to-skin contact. In kangaroo care, the baby is supposed to be naked by only wearing a cloth piece or a diaper on the back and therefore he or she is placed in the parent's breast area holding an upright position. It was first developed during the 1970s.

In the question above, the given statement is an example of kangaroo care.
